Communications, Outreach & Knowledge Management Specialist

Communications, Outreach & Knowledge Management Specialist
The Global e-Schools and Communities Initiative (GESCI) is an international non-profit technicalassistance organization, established by the UN and headquartered in Nairobi, Kenya which has amandate to advise and assist Governments in the socio-economic development of their countries through the widespread integration of technology for knowledge society development, especially in the education, skills training and community development areas.In particular, GESCI partners Governments in effective policy making for education provision with an    emphasis on the systematic use and integration of technology. Currently GESCI works with 13 East and southern and West Africa Governments in leadership development programmes for policy-making for social, economic and knowledge society development.Effective communications and Knowledge Management are central to GESCI’s operations. The role is two-fold to cover the complementary functions of internal and external organisational communications, public relations, outreach and publicity on the one hand as well as the development and management of processes, tools and reporting mechanisms associated with knowledge creation, sharing and distribution on the other hand.Communications, public relations and publicity responsibilities:The primary function of this dimension of the role is to ensure consistency in organisational messages and to promote and maintain a positive organisational image. While many jobs require a unique set of skills, there is a pretty standard set of qualities that most employers want in an employee. Increase your chances of landing the job you want by highlighting your "soft" skills as well as your technical skills in the interview. Employers look for a variety of strengths, including:Communication: You can communicate clearly and concisely both verbally and in writing.

Identify your skills and recognize their value Tell me about yourself. That is usually one of the first things that an employer will say in an interview. What he/she is really asking is what qualifies you for this position. Your response will set the tone for the rest of the interview, so your best bet is to prepare your answer in advance.Think of your answer as a 60-second commercial in which you sell yourself. Know the job description for the position you are going for and tailor your comments to match.

Create a Great Resume The purpose of a resume is to highlight your qualifications and get you an interview. Your resume, along with your cover letter, introduces you to an employer. It lets him/her know who you are and what you have to offer.The perfect resume is targeted to the specifics of the job description. Tailoring your resume shows that you’ve done your homework and highlights the skills you possess that are relevant to the job.
